jQuery let()是一個全新的方法,它用于創(chuàng)建一個局部變量。這個方法提供了一個非常便捷的方式來創(chuàng)建一個臨時變量,無需在全局范圍內(nèi)定義它。jQuery let()方法返回一個包含所有已定義變量的對象。
$('button').click(function() { let num = 1; $('p').text(num); //1 $('li').each(function(index) { let count = index + 1; $('p').text(count); //1 2 3 4 5 }); });
上面的代碼演示了如何在循環(huán)中使用jQuery let()方法,創(chuàng)建一個局部變量count,它存儲每個li元素的索引加1。通過let方法,我們可以輕松地創(chuàng)建局部變量,而不會產(chǎn)生全局變量的不必要干擾。
需要注意的是,jQuery let()方法只能在ES6中使用,如果你的瀏覽器不支持ES6,你需要使用一個 polyfill 庫來模擬 let() 方法。例如,Chrome中已經(jīng)支持 let() 方法,但如果你想要在IE11中使用let()方法,則需要加載一個 polyfill 庫,如 Babel。
總之,jQuery let()方法是一個非常有用的方法,它為我們提供了一個便捷的方式來創(chuàng)建局部變量,從而優(yōu)化代碼的可維護性和可讀性。
上一篇mysql命令沒有用
下一篇CSS代碼表白男朋友視頻